Details about the schedules of the workshops are below.



Starting Lean: Value Proposition

Session 1 – Preparing to leave the building (May 11,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

Establish a process to clarify and test key assumptions you have about your business and lower your ventures overall risk.

Deliverable: Overview of the Lean Startup approach and a tested interview guide based on the venture’s most important foundational assumptions.

Session 2 – Determining your value proposition (May 18,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

Use data obtained from customer interviews to synthesize customer feedback into a value proposition.

Deliverable: A framework and template for determining your value proposition.

Starting Lean: Business Model

Session 1 – Designing your business model (May 25,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

Use your value proposition to test your business model for sustainability and growth.

Deliverable: A business model designed around the participant’s value proposition.

Session 2 – Validating your business model (June 1,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

Analyze external factors and test your business model for sustainability and growth.

Deliverable: A framework for validating your business model that analyzes external forces and key business model metrics.

Finance Fundamentals

Session 1 – Preparing your business forecast (June 8,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

In this session, we help entrepreneurs understand the basics of financial statements, management reporting and how to build a detailed cash flow forecast to be used in making day-to-day business decisions around growth.

Deliverable: Expense budget template for your business.

Session 2 – Understanding revenue forecasting, funding and business valuation

(June 15 , 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

In the second session, we will use your cash flow forecast and add revenue estimates by taking you through inputs such as pricing, sales funnel and revenue types resulting in a complete cash flow forecasting model you can use in your business. Entrepreneurs will also learn the basic concepts surrounding different types of business valuations and the inputs and factors that impact valuation from an investor perspective.

Deliverable: Basic complete 12-month cash flow forecast for your business.

Session 3 - Business Valuation and Tutorial Session (June 22, 2016 // 9:00am-1:00pm)

First half: Outline basic concepts surrounding different types of business valuations, and the inputs and factors that impact valuation from an investor perspective.

Second half: Working session/finance lab.

Deliverable: Basic complete 12-month cash flow forecast for your business.

The Entrepreneur's Toolkit Workshops are a collection of experiential, hands-on workshops facilitated by experienced entrepreneurs. Workshops are designed for a maximum of 30 participants and allow time for exercises and peer-to-peer feedback on their own ventures.
